Webb8 juli 2024 · For each type of correlation, there is a range of strong correlations and weak correlations. Correlation values closer to zero are weaker correlations, while values closer to positive or negative one are stronger correlation. Strong correlations show more obvious trends in the data, while weak ones look messier.
